How Can You Create Custom Digital Folders for GoodNotes 5? Step-by-step Guide
Step 1: Launch Keynote
Open the Keynote app on your iPad.
Step 2: Create a New Blank Document
Tap on the “+” icon to create a new blank document.
Choose “Basic White” as the template.
Step 3: Adjust Document Settings
Clear the existing content from the blank page.
Tap on the three dots (…) and select “Document Setup.”
Under “Slide Size,” choose “Custom.”
Set the dimensions to 2388 (width) by 1638 (height).
Step 4: Design Your Folder
Tap the “+” icon and select “Shapes.”
Choose a shape with rounded edges to design your folder.
Adjust the size and shape according to your preference, leaving space at the top for a tab.
Step 5: Customize Folder Appearance
Tap the paintbrush icon to modify the folder’s fill color.
Choose a suitable background color (e.g., gray) for the folder.
Enable the shadow effect to add depth and realism.
Step 6: Add Tab
Tap the “+” icon again and select a tab shape from the shapes menu.
Position the tab appropriately on your folder design.
Ensure the tab is positioned behind the folder shape for a realistic look.
Step 7: Insert Clip Art or Image
Tap the “+” icon and select “Photos” or “Clip Art.”
Choose an image or clip art to embellish your folder.
Resize and position the image to fit neatly in the folder.
Step 8: Fine-Tune Details
Adjust colors and shadows to create a cohesive design.
Ensure all elements are aligned and proportional for a polished appearance.
Step 9: Export as PDF
Tap on the three dots (…) and select “Export.”
Choose “PDF” format for exporting.
Enable “Print Builds” and “Print Background” options.
Export and save the PDF document.
Step 10: Import into GoodNotes 5
Open GoodNotes 5.
Import the PDF document you created.
Rename the document and organize it within GoodNotes.
Step 11: Customize and Use
Add pages, notes, or documents within your customized folder in GoodNotes.
Utilize tabs and sections for efficient organization.
Edit folder names and contents as needed directly in GoodNotes.
